Japanese professional soccer and baseball to remain in shutdown

Nippon Professional Baseball and the Japanese J.League said Monday that they cannot set a specific date at least until after the Japanese government ends its current coronavirus state of emergency.

Officials from both Japanese baseball and soccer spoke after receiving advice from medical experts during a seventh meeting of their joint panel to assess the virus outbreak.

J.League announced earlier to suspend matches up to June 7 on account of the novel coronavirus (COVID-19) outbreak and NPB already decided its season openers will not take place in May.

The Japanese government extended the nationwide state of emergency through the end of May.
